Day Trading Strategies for Consistent Gains

Navigating this volatile world of day trading requires a keen eye and a disciplined approach. Achieving regular gains isn't luck, it's the outcome of employing proven strategies and adhering to a strict trading method. Several popular day trading strategies include:

  • Scalping: Utilizing short-term price fluctuations, scalpers aim for quick profits by making multiple trades during a single session.
  • Range Trading: These strategies exploit the natural tendency of prices to oscillate around an average. Mean reversion traders buy low and sell high, while trend followers ride the wave.
  • Breakout Trading: Spotting significant price movements, these strategies focus on breakouts from established support and resistance levels. Gap traders take advantage of sudden price gaps that appear at the opening of a trading day or session.

Remember, successful day trading requires consistent practice, discipline, and risk management. It's crucial to develop your own strategy, backtest it rigorously, and always trade with defined risk tolerance. Never invest more than you can afford to lose.

Leveraging Frequency for Day Traders

Day trading demands an edge in today's fast-paced market. One strategy gaining traction is high-frequency trading (HFT), which involves executing numerous transactions at lightning speed. To capitalize on this method, traders must implement advanced tools. These include sophisticated programs capable of analyzing market signals and identifying profitable opportunities in real-time.

Successful HFT requires a deep understanding of market mechanics, technical analysis, and risk management.

Traders must be able to forecast price movements and execute trades within milliseconds.

To gain an edge, day traders exploring HFT should:

* **Master Algorithmic Trading:** Develop or acquire programs that can autonomously analyze market data and generate trade signals.

* **Optimize Execution Speed:** Utilize high-performance hardware and low-latency connections to ensure rapid order execution.

* **Employ Risk Management Strategies:** Implement robust stop-loss orders and position sizing techniques to mitigate potential losses.

The path to success in HFT is demanding, requiring constant learning and adaptation. Traders must be willing to invest time and resources into mastering the complexities of this highly competitive domain.
